In this report, 2018 has been considered as the base year and 2019 to 2025 as the forecast period to estimate the market size for Near-infrared Spectroscope.

This report studies the global market size of Near-infrared Spectroscope, especially focuses on the key regions like United States, European Union, China, and other regions (Japan, Korea, India and Southeast Asia).
This study presents the Near-infrared Spectroscope production, revenue, market share and growth rate for each key company, and also covers the breakdown data (production, consumption, revenue and market share) by regions, type and applications. history breakdown data from 2014 to 2019, and forecast to 2025.
For top companies in United States, European Union and China, this report investigates and analyzes the production, value, price, market share and growth rate for the top manufacturers, key data from 2014 to 2019.

In global market, the following companies are covered:
Thermo Fisher
Bruker
Buchi Labortechnik
Agilent Technologies
Foss A/S
Shimadzu
PerkinElmer
Sartorius
Jasco
Yokogawa Electric
ABB
Kett Electric

Market Segment by Product Type
FT-NIR
UV-Vis-NIR
Other

Market Segment by Application
Polymer Industry
Food and Agriculture Industry
Pharmaceutical Industry
Oil and Gas Industry

Key Regions split in this report: breakdown data for each region.
United States
China
European Union
Rest of World (Japan, Korea, India and Southeast Asia)
